4/A: Crown Castle Executive Corrects Beneficial Ownership Report
SEC Filing Amendment
Edmond Chan, EVP and CIO of Crown Castle, files an amended Form 4 to correct a clerical error in the reported amount of directly held common stock.
Summary
- Edmond Chan, an executive at Crown Castle Inc., filed an amendment to a previously submitted Form 4.
- The amendment corrects a clerical error in the number of shares of common stock directly owned by Chan after transactions on February 19, 2025.
- The corrected number of directly held shares is 7,100, replacing the previously reported 12,780 shares.
- Subsequent filings will reflect this corrected number.

Industry Context
Form 4 filings are standard practice for reporting changes in beneficial ownership by company insiders, ensuring transparency and compliance with SEC regulations.
